Urban Air Mobility Market Analysis and Insights

The urban air mobility market size is valued at USD 26,150.23 million by 2028 and is expected to grow at a compound annual growth rate of 13.50% over the forecast period of 2021 to 2028. Urban air mobility is also known as UAM, and is an industry term which is used to refer cargo or passenger carrying, highly automated, and on demand services of air transportation. It is an inventive mode of transportation to avoid traffic congestion on road.

The urban air mobility market has a huge potential and is expected grow over the forecast period of 2021 to 2028, owing to the rise in the need for efficient mode of logistics and last-mile delivery. In addition, the high demand for alternative mode of transportation in urban mobility and smart city initiatives are also largely influencing the growth of the urban air mobility market. Also the high disposable incomes in developing countries and rise in demand for an alternative mode of transportation in urban mobility are another driver anticipated to flourish the urban air mobility market growth. Additionally, the increase in government funding is also expected to boost the growth of the urban air mobility market in the above mentioned forecast period.

However, the market of urban air mobility though has certain limitations which are expected to obstruct the potential growth of the market such as the legal and regulatory barriers and less adoption due to political, economic, social, technological and legal factors, whereas the designing and implementing required ground infrastructure can challenge the growth of the urban air mobility market in the above mentioned forecast period.

  • In addition, the high demand for autonomous air ambulance vehicles, rapid technological advancements and increase in the environmental concerns are projected to offer various growth opportunities for the urban air mobility market in the forecast period of 2021 to 2028.

Global Urban Air Mobility Market Scope and Market Size

The urban air mobility market is segmented on the basis of component, architecture, range, operation, unmanned platform system and end user. The growth among segments helps you analyze niche pockets of growth and strategies to approach the market and determine your core application areas and the difference in your target markets.

Based on component, the urban air mobility market is segmented into infrastructure and platform. Infrastructure has further been segmented into charging stations, vertiports, air traffic management facilities and maintenance facilities. Platform has further been segmented into air taxis, air shuttles and air metro, personal air vehicles, cargo air vehicles, air ambulance and medical emergency vehicles and last-mile delivery vehicles. Air taxis have further been sub-segmented into manned air taxis and drone taxis.

  • On the basis of architecture, the urban air mobility market is segmented into rotary wing and fixed-wing hybrid. Rotary wing has further been segmented into helicopters and multicopters. Fixed-wing hybrid has further been segmented into tilt rotor and vector thrust.
  • On the basis of range, the urban air mobility market is segmented into intercity (100 kilometers to 400 kilometers) and intracity (20 kilometers to 100 kilometers).

Based on operation, the urban air mobility market is segmented into piloted, autonomous and hybrid. Autonomous has further been segmented into remotely/optionally piloted and fully autonomous.

The unmanned platform system segment of the urban air mobility market is segmented into aerostructures, avionics, electrical systems, propulsion systems, cabin interiors and software. Avionics have further been segmented into flight control systems, navigation systems, communication systems and sensors. Sensors have further been sub-segmented into speed sensors, light sensors, proximity sensors, position sensors and temperature sensors. Propulsion systems have further been segmented into electric batteries, solar cells, fuel cells and hybrid electric. Electrical systems have further been segmented into generators, motors, electric actuators, electric pumps and distribution devices.

Based on end user, the urban air mobility market is segmented into ride sharing companies, scheduled operators, e-commerce companies, hospitals and medical agencies and private operators.

North America leads the urban air mobility market because of the large market share of the U.S. Europe is expected to expand at a significant growth rate over the forecast period of 2021 to 2028 because of the rise in the number of urban air mobility projects and increase in the investment on the transportation activities.

The major players covered in the urban air mobility market report are Wisk Aero LLC, LILIUM, Volocopter GmbH, Honeywell International Inc., TE Connectivity, Airbus S.A.S., Jaunt Air Mobility LLC, Joby Aviation, Archer Aviation, Lockheed Martin Corporation, NEVA Aerospace, Opener, Pipistrel Group, EHang, KITTY HAWK, AutoFlightX GmbH, SKYPORTS LIMITED, VERDEGO AERO, Hyundai Motor Company and Bell Textron Inc., among other domestic and global players.
